Kathryn and Quauhtli = Married

A large part of my photography business comes from referrals from friends, family, and former clients. I’d met Kathryn a year or two (I don’t remember!) ago through my sister in law, Mary. Well, here it is, a couple of years later, Kathryn has graduated and I hear from my sister (in law) that she’s looking for a wedding photographer. Honestly, the kindest thing anyone could do, and it truly touches my heart, is when they refer me to friends or family.

I finally had the chance to meet with Kathryn and Beverly in Chapel Hill right after we moved down, and despite me being late for the first time (ever! go figure…!) for a customer consultation, they decided to hire me to photograph their engagement session and their wedding.

I got my first chance to meet Quauhtli at their engagement session. I just have to say, I think they’re a perfect fit. Quauhtli thinks of Kathryn first when he makes decisions, and they truly consult with one another before making decisions; the two of them have become a great team! I get to photograph many weddings and engagement sessions, but it’s rare to find a couple more in sync and honest with one another than Kathryn and Quauhtli- you can just see it in the way he looks at her, and how they are together. It’s what makes this little job of mine so special.

Onto the wedding…

I’ve not had much luck with weddings and weather this year. 50% of the weddings I’ve photographed in 2010 have had the blessing of rain, which is tremendous for a wedding, but not so great with bridesmaids and logistics. Kathryn and Quauhtli were cool and calm before the ceremony, which was at The Stone Chapel in Wake Forest, NC. After a touching and moving ceremony full of worship, praise, friendship, and love, we moved onto the reception, which was down the road at the classic The Cotton Company.
